4. Installation Instructions

These step bars feature an easy bolt-on, no-drill application, utilizing existing factory mounting points on your vehicle's frame.

4.1 Tools Required

  • Socket Wrench Set
  • Torque Wrench
  • Measuring Tape
  • Safety Glasses and Gloves

4.2 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Identify Mounting Locations: Locate the factory mounting points along the rocker panel or frame of your GM Silverado/Sierra Crew Cab. These are typically existing holes or bolts used for cab mounts.
  2. Attach Brackets: Secure the custom carbon steel mounting brackets to the vehicle's frame using the provided hardware. Ensure the front, middle, and rear brackets are correctly oriented for the driver's side. Some models may have additional reinforcing mounts.
  3. Initial Bracket Tightening: Hand-tighten all hardware for the brackets. Do not fully tighten at this stage to allow for adjustment.
  4. Position Step Bar: Carefully lift the step bar and align it with the attached mounting brackets. Secure the step bar to the brackets using the remaining hardware.
  5. Adjust and Align: Adjust the step bar and brackets to ensure the step bar is parallel to the truck body and properly positioned. This step is crucial for aesthetic appeal and proper function.
  6. Final Tightening: Once satisfied with the alignment, progressively tighten all hardware to the manufacturer's recommended torque specifications (refer to your vehicle's service manual or a general automotive torque specification guide if not provided). Start from the center and work outwards.
  7. Repeat for Other Side: Follow the same procedure for the passenger side step bar.

Important Note: Some users have reported challenges in achieving perfect parallelism between the step bar and the truck body due to bracket design. Take extra time during the adjustment phase (Step 5) to ensure optimal alignment before final tightening.

6. Maintenance

To ensure the longevity and appearance of your stainless steel step bars, follow these maintenance guidelines:

  • Cleaning: Wash the step bars regularly with mild soap and water. For stubborn dirt or road grime, use a non-abrasive automotive cleaner designed for stainless steel. Rinse thoroughly and dry with a soft cloth to prevent water spots.
  • Inspection: Periodically inspect all mounting hardware (bolts, nuts, washers, brackets) for tightness. Re-tighten any loose fasteners to prevent rattling or potential detachment. Check for any signs of corrosion, cracks, or damage to the step bars or brackets.
  • Protection: While stainless steel is corrosion-resistant, applying a quality automotive wax or polish can provide an extra layer of protection and maintain its polished finish.

7. Troubleshooting

ProblemPossible CauseSolution
Step bar appears loose or rattles.Loose mounting hardware.Inspect and re-tighten all bolts and nuts on the mounting brackets and step bar attachment points.
Step bar is not parallel to the vehicle body.Brackets or step bar not properly aligned during installation.Loosen mounting hardware, adjust the position of the brackets and step bar, then re-tighten. Ensure even spacing.
Corrosion or rust spots appear on stainless steel.Exposure to harsh chemicals, road salt, or lack of regular cleaning.Clean thoroughly with a stainless steel cleaner. For minor spots, a fine-grit polishing compound may be used. Apply a protective wax.

8. Specifications

  • Model Number: 402229
  • Material: High Quality 304 Polished Stainless Steel
  • Step Pad Size: 5 inches (width)
  • Application: GM Silverado/Sierra Crew Cab
  • Installation: Bolt-on, No-Drill
  • Item Dimensions (L x W x H): 88 x 9 x 13 inches
  • Item Weight: Approximately 64.6 pounds
  • Manufacturer: Steelcraft
